A line passes through the point (4, -4) and has a slope of -5/4

Write an equation in slope intercept form for this line.​

Answers

Answer 1

Answer:

y= -5/4x + 1

Step-by-step explanation:

Slope-intercept form: y=mx+b

M is the slope

B is the y-intercept.

The slope is -5/4.

M = -5/4

y = -5/4 + b

We're looking for the y-intercept. Substitute point in.

(4,-4) x= 4 y= -4

-4 = -5/4(4) + b

-4 = -5+b

b= 1

y= -5/4x + 1

An electronics company just finished designing a new tablet computer and is interested in estimating its battery-life. A random sample of 20 laptops with a full charge was tested and the battery-life was found to be approximately normal with a mean of 6 hours and a sample standard deviation of 1.5 hours. Which of the following is the correct form for a 99% confidence interval?
a) .99( ) 6 2.576(0.3354) CI
b) .99( ) 6 2.576(1.5) CI
c) .99( ) 6 2.861(0.3354)CI
d) .99( ) 6 2.861(1.5) CI

Answers

Answer:

[tex]6 \pm 2.861(0.3354)[/tex]

Step-by-step explanation:

We have the standard deviation for the sample, so we use the t-distribution to solve this question.

The first step to solve this problem is finding how many degrees of freedom, we have. This is the sample size subtracted by 1. So

df = 20 - 1 = 19

99% confidence interval

Now, we have to find a value of T, which is found looking at the t table, with 19 degrees of freedom(y-axis) and a confidence level of [tex]1 - \frac{1 - 0.99}{2} = 0.995[/tex]. So we have T = 2.861.

The margin of error is:

[tex]M = T\frac{s}{\sqrt{n}} = 2.861\frac{1.5}{\sqrt{20}} = 2.861(0.3354)[/tex]

In which s is the standard deviation of the sample and n is the size of the sample.

The format of the confidence interval is:

[tex]S_{M} \pm M[/tex]

In which [tex]S_{M}[/tex] is the sample mean

So

[tex]6 \pm 2.861(0.3354)[/tex]

In 1994 the city of Anoka had a population of 18,000 people. Since then the population has grown by 5.2% each year. In 1994 the city of Minneapolis had a population of 390,000 and has been decreasing by 2.3% each year. How many more people will be living in Minneapolis compared to Anoka after 25 years?

Answers

Answer:

After 25 years, Minneapolis will have 154,062 more residents than Anoka.

Step-by-step explanation:

First, let's write a function for each case.

For Anoka, the initial population is 18,000. The population grows 5.2% or 0.052 each year. Thus:

[tex]A(x)=18000(1.052)^x[/tex], where x represents the amount of years after 1994.

Inversely, for Minneapolis, the population decreases by 2.3% or 0.023. Another way to write this is that it in changes by 1-0.023 or .977 or 97.7%. Thus:

[tex]M(x)=390000(0.977)^x[/tex].

To find how many more people are living in Minneapolis than Anoka after 25 years, simply plug 25 into the functions and then subtract.

In Anoka, after 25 years, there will be:

[tex]A(25)=18000(1.052)^{25}\approx 63924[/tex] residents.

In Minneapolis, after 25 years, there will be:

[tex]M(25)=390000(.977)^{25}\approx217986[/tex] residents.

217986-63924=154,062 residents.

Dr. Pagels is a mammalogist who studies meadow and common voles. He frequently traps the moles and has noticed what appears to be a preference for a peanut butter-oatmeal mixture by the meadow voles vs apple slices are usually used in traps, where the common voles seem to prefer the apple slices. So he conducted a study where he used a peanut butter-oatmeal mixture in half the traps and the normal apple slices in his remaining traps to see if there was a food preference between the two different voles.
Indicate which of the following is the null hypothesis, and which is the alternate hypothesis.
There food preferences among vole species are independent of one another. _____
There is a relationship between voles and food preference. ______
To test for independence, we need to calculate the Chi-square statistic.
These are the data that Dr. Pagels collected:
meadow voles common voles
apple slices 26 32
peanut butter-oatmeal 35 25

Step-by-step explanation:

He frequently traps the moles and has noticed what appears to be a preference for a peanut butter-oatmeal mixture by the meadow voles vs apple slices are usually used in traps, where the common voles seem to prefer the apple slices.

So he conducted a study where he used a peanut butter-oatmeal mixture in half the traps and the normal apple slices in his remaining traps to see if there was a food preference between the two different voles.

Null hypothesis = H₀ = There food preferences among vole species are independent of one another.

Alternate hypothesis = H₁ = There is a relationship between voles and food preference.

Data collected by Dr. Pagels:

                                              meadow voles     common voles      Row Total

apple slices                                     26                          32                      58

peanut butter-oatmeal                   35                          25                     60

Column Total                                   61                          57                     118

Where 118 is the grand total.

The expected number is given by

Expected = (row total)×(column total)/grand total

Expected meadow vole/apple slices = 58×61/118

Expected meadow vole/apple slices = 29.983051

Expected common vole/apple slices = 58×57/118

Expected common vole/apple slices = 28.016949

Expected meadow vole/peanut butter-oatmeal = 60×61/118

Expected meadow vole/peanut butter-oatmeal = 31.016949

Expected common vole/peanut butter-oatmeal = 60×57/118

Expected common vole/peanut butter-oatmeal = 28.983051

The chi-square statistic value is given by

χ² = Σ(Observed - Expected)²/Expected

χ² = (26 - 29.983051)²/29.983051 + (32 - 28.016949)²/28.016949 + (35 - 31.016949)²/31.016949 + (25 - 28.983051)²/28.983051

χ² = 2.154239

The degrees of freedom is given by

DoF = (row - 1)×(col - 1)

For the given case, we have 2 rows and 2 columns

DoF = (2 - 1)×(2 - 1)

DoF = 1

The given level of significance = 0.05

The critical value from the chi-square table at α = 0.05 and DoF = 1 is found to be

Critical value = 3.841

Conclusion:

Reject H₀ If χ² > Critical value

We reject the Null hypothesis If the calculated chi-square value is more than the critical value.

For the given case,

χ² < Critical value

We failed to reject H₀

We do not have significant evidence at the given significance level to show that there is a relationship between voles and food preference.

a triangle with all sides of equal length is a ------ triangle

Answers

Answer:

equilateral

Step-by-step explanation:

There are various types of triangles out there, each with its own unique characteristics that distinguish it from others.

One such triangle is called an equilateral triangle. Essentially, like its name suggests, this kind of triangle has all three angles equal (they're actually all equal to 60 degrees). Additionally, this triangle has all three sides that same, as well.

Thus, the answer is equilateral.

Just for future reference, here are a couple more types of triangles:

- Isosceles

These triangles have at least 2 sides equal to each other; in other words, an equilateral triangle is an example of an isosceles triangle. In addition, the two angles of an isosceles triangle opposite to the two equal sides are themselves congruent.

- Scalene

These triangles have all three sides different, which in turn means that all three angles are distinct.

- Acute

These triangles' angles are all less than 90 degrees. That's what "acute" means: less than 90 degrees.

- Obtuse

These triangles have exactly 1 angle that is larger than 90 degrees.

- Right

These triangles have exactly 1 angle that is equal to 90 degrees.

Bill and Ben each have three cards numbered 4,5,6 they each take one of their own cards then they add the two numbers on the cards what is the probability that their answer is an odd number. What is the probability that their answer is a number less than 11.

Answers

Answer:

P(odd) = 4/9P(<11) = 2/3

Step-by-step explanation:

There are 9 possible outcomes for (Bill, Ben)'s cards:

  (4, 4) total 8; (4, 5) total 9; (4, 6) total 10;

  (5, 4) total 9; (5, 5) total 10; (5, 6) total 11;

  (6, 4) total 10; (6, 5) total 11; (6, 6) total 12.

Of these 9 outcomes, 4 have an odd total; 6 are less than 11.

 P(odd) = 4/9

  P(sum < 11) = 2/3
